The Ultimate Guide to Aquarium Volume: How to Calculate Tank Size AccuratelyEstablishing a brand-new aquarium is an amazing endeavor. Whether one is preparing a lavish planted aquascape, a vibrant neighborhood of freshwater fish, or a delicate saltwater reef, the structure of every effective tank lies in one essential metric: water volume. Understanding the specific volume of an aquarium is not simply a matter of curiosity; it is vital for the health and wellness of aquatic life. From dosing medications and plant fertilizers to determining proper equipping levels, precision is essential. Counting on rough estimates can cause overstocking, under-medicating, or chemical imbalances. This extensive guide explores the significance of computing aquarium volume, provides standard formulas for different tank shapes, and provides useful pointers for guaranteeing accuracy.Why Knowing Your Aquarium's Exact Volume MattersLots of newbie aquarists make the mistake of assuming their tank holds the exact quantity of water advertised on package. For instance, a "55-gallon tank" rarely holds a complete 55 gallons of water when substrate, driftwood, rocks, and equipment are included. Here are the main reasons that calculating the true net water volume is essential:Accurate Medication Dosing: Under-dosing can render treatments inadequate, permitting diseases to persist. Over-dosing can poison delicate fish, invertebrates, and live plants.Appropriate Stocking Levels: The traditional "one inch of fish per gallon" rule is greatly flawed, but understanding the precise water volume assists aquarists follow reliable bio-load guidelines (such as the AqAdvisor calculator).Water Conditioner and Additives: Dechlorinators, pH adjusters, and micronutrient must be determined exactly based on the volume of water being treated during water modifications.Fertilizer Regimens: Calculate Litres In Fish Tank planted tanks, computing water volume guarantees that macro and micro-nutrients are supplied at ideal levels without activating algae blooms.Standard Aquarium Shapes and FormulasDetermining volume depends entirely on the geometry of the tank. Below are the standard mathematical solutions used in an aquarium volume calculator to identify overall capacity in both gallons and liters.1. Rectangular AquariumsThe most typical and straightforward tank shape. To discover the volume, determine the interior length, width, and height.Formula (Inches): ₤ \ text Volume (Gallons) = \ frac \ text Length \ times \ text Width \ times \ text Height 231 ₤Formula (Centimeters): ₤ \ text Volume (Liters) = \ frac \ text Length \ times \ text Width \ times \ text Height 1000 ₤2. Bow-Front AquariumsBow-front tanks include a curved front glass that broadens the seeing location. Due to the fact that of the curve, basic rectangle-shaped solutions will overstate the volume.Approximation Formula (Inches): ₤ \ text Volume (Gallons) = \ frac \ text Length \ times (\ text Width + \ text Optimum Depth) \ div 2 \ times \ text Height 231 ₤3. Cylinder AquariumsCylindrical tanks provide a special 360-degree watching experience. The formula counts on the radius (half of the size) and the height.Formula (Inches): ₤ \ text Volume (Gallons) = \ frac \ pi \ times \ text radius ^ 2 \ times \ text Height 231 ₤ (Note: ₤ \ pi \ approx 3.1416 ₤)4. Hexagonal AquariumsHexagonal tanks have 6 sides. Gross Volume: This is the overall geometric capacity of the empty tank. If water were filled entirely to the outright brim, this is what the tank would hold.Net Volume: This is the real amount of water present in the system throughout normal operation.Aspects That Reduce Net Water VolumeWhen determining how much water is really in an aquarium, numerous displacement factors should be deducted from the gross volume:Substrate: Gravel, sand, and aqusoil use up substantial area. A 2-inch layer of substrate in a 55-gallon tank can quickly displace 5 to 7 gallons of water.Hardscape: Large pieces of driftwood, lava rock, dragon stone, and slate displace water proportional to their mass.The Water Line: Aquariums are hardly ever filled to the outright edge. A standard clearance of 1 inch at the top for surface agitation and devices avoids Fish Tank Stock Calculator from leaping out, however lowers overall water volume.3D Backgrounds and Internal Filters: Silicone-bonded 3D foam backgrounds or large internal filter boxes displace an unexpected amount of water.Step-by-Step Guide: How to Measure an Irregular TankFor custom-made tanks, corner systems, or uncommon shapes that do not healthy standard mathematical designs, manual measurement is needed. Action 1: Measure Interior Dimensions. Always determine the inside of the tank rather than the outside. Determining the outside includes the density of the glass, which will synthetically pump up the volume calculation.Action 2: Convert to Inches or Centimeters. For gallons, procedure in inches. For liters, measure in centimeters.Action 3: Apply the Appropriate Formula. Divide the cubic measurement by the conversion aspect (231 for US Gallons, 1,000 for Liters).Step 4: Account for Displacement. Utilize the pail approach during the initial fill to discover the exact net volume.The Bucket Method (The Most Accurate Technique)For outright accuracy, particularly in intricate aquascapes, use the pail method:Use a marked pail or container of a recognized volume (e.g., a 1-gallon or 5-gallon container).Fill the tank slowly utilizing just determined buckets of water.Keep a tally of every pail added up until the tank reaches its normal operating water level.The last tally equates to the exact net water volume of the system.Finest Practices for Tank Maintenance Based on VolumeAs soon as the exact water volume is established, preserving the aquarium ends up being much more methodical. Water Change Calculations: Most hobbyists go for a 20% to 30% weekly water change. Understanding the precise net volume makes sure that the proper quantity of old water is gotten rid of and replaced, and that the proper dose of water conditioner is included for just the new water being introduced.Medication Protocols: Always compute medication does based upon the net volume (minus substrate and hardscape), not the manufacturer's nominal tank size.
